February 23, 201016 yr HelloI've just bought FS Global 2010 to replace FS Global 2008. However I thoughtlessy uninstalled the FS Global 2008 program without switching back to the default FSX meshes first. Now when I look in the FSX Scenery Library tab in settings the FS Global 2008 meshes are still there. I don't want to install FS Global 2010 untill the old FS Global 2008 meshs have been removed and the default FSX meshes are back in place. Does anyone know how to do this?

Does anyone know how to do this?Personally I would first delete the items from the FSX library and then take a flight to see if the mesh has actually been removed or still in place. If still in place I would do the following:1) Reinstall FSGlobal 20082) Start up FSX3) Remove the relevent entries from the scenery library4) Take a flight to make sure mesh is no longer present5) Shutdown FSX6) Uninstall FSGlobal20087) Startup and then close FSX8) Install FS2010Thats all. Hope this helps.
